Shahrooz Rahmati is a scholar working on Biomedical Engineering, Molecular Biology and Electrical and Electronic Engineering. According to data from OpenAlex, Shahrooz Rahmati has authored 15 papers receiving a total of 609 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Biomedical Engineering, 7 papers in Molecular Biology and 3 papers in Electrical and Electronic Engineering. Recurrent topics in Shahrooz Rahmati’s work include Advanced biosensing and bioanalysis techniques (4 papers), Catalysis for Biomass Conversion (3 papers) and Biofuel production and bioconversion (3 papers). Shahrooz Rahmati is often cited by papers focused on Advanced biosensing and bioanalysis techniques (4 papers), Catalysis for Biomass Conversion (3 papers) and Biofuel production and bioconversion (3 papers). Shahrooz Rahmati collaborates with scholars based in Malaysia, Australia and China. Shahrooz Rahmati's co-authors include Nurhidayatullaili Muhd Julkapli, Wageeh A. Yehye, Wan Jefrey Basirun, Kostya Ostrikov, William O.S. Doherty, Ibrahim Khalil, Aminah Abdullah, Arman Amani Babadi, Rafieh Fakhlaei and Shuang Wang and has published in prestigious journals such as Scientific Reports, Electrochimica Acta and Green Chemistry.
